Universal Orlando Launches Weeklong Park-to-Park Tickets With Limited-Time ‘Buy 5, Get Up to 2 Days Free’ Deal

The limited-time pricing underscores Universal’s push to make full-week stays the norm after Epic Universe’s debut.

Overview

  • New six- and seven-day park-to-park tickets include access to Universal Studios Florida, Islands of Adventure, Epic Universe, and optional Volcano Bay.
  • For a limited time, the 6–7 day products are sold for the price of a 5-day ticket, with example per-day rates starting around $65 without Volcano Bay and about $75 with it on select dates.
  • The offer is available to U.S. residents with date-based pricing, and first-valid start dates are currently shown online through mid-October 2026.
  • Tickets must be used over eight consecutive days for 6-day products and nine for 7-day products, with park hopping permitted including use of the Hogwarts Express.
  • A companion hotel promotion offers a $300 dining credit on 5+ night stays at Cabana Bay, Aventura, Stella Nova, and Terra Luna between April 12 and September 3, 2026, with standard terms applying such as non-transferable tickets, parking not included, and select Volcano Bay closure dates.
